UNPKG

ngx-tencent-im

Version:
10 lines 1.91 kB
import { createReducer, on } from '@ngrx/store'; import { loginAction, } from '../actions'; export const initialState = { isLogin: false, }; const _loginReducer = createReducer(initialState, on(loginAction, (state, { isLogin }) => ({ ...state, isLogin }))); export function LoginReducer(state, action) { return _loginReducer(state, action); } //#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oibG9naW4ucmVkdWNlci5qcyIsInNvdXJjZVJvb3QiOiIiLCJzb3VyY2VzIjpbIi4uLy4uLy4uLy4uLy4uL3Byb2plY3RzL25neC10ZW5jZW50LWltL3NyYy9zdG9yZS9yZWR1Y2VyL2xvZ2luLnJlZHVjZXIudHMiXSwibmFtZXMiOltdLCJtYXBwaW5ncyI6IkFBQ0EsT0FBTyxFQUFVLGFBQWEsRUFBRSxFQUFFLEVBQUUsTUFBTSxhQUFhLENBQUM7QUFDeEQsT0FBTyxFQUFFLFdBQVcsR0FBRyxNQUFNLFlBQVksQ0FBQztBQU8xQyxNQUFNLENBQUMsTUFBTSxZQUFZLEdBQWU7SUFDdEMsT0FBTyxFQUFFLEtBQUs7Q0FDZixDQUFDO0FBRUYsTUFBTSxhQUFhLEdBQUcsYUFBYSxDQUNqQyxZQUFZLEVBQ1osRUFBRSxDQUFDLFdBQVcsRUFBRSxDQUFDLEtBQUssRUFBRSxFQUFFLE9BQU8sRUFBRSxFQUFFLEVBQUUsQ0FBQyxDQUFDLEVBQUUsR0FBRyxLQUFLLEVBQUUsT0FBTyxFQUFFLENBQUMsQ0FBQyxDQUNqRSxDQUFDO0FBRUYsTUFBTSxVQUFVLFlBQVksQ0FBQyxLQUE2QixFQUFFLE1BQWM7SUFDeEUsT0FBTyxhQUFhLENBQUMsS0FBSyxFQUFFLE1BQU0sQ0FBQyxDQUFDO0FBQ3RDLENBQUMiLCJzb3VyY2VzQ29udGVudCI6WyJcclxuaW1wb3J0IHsgQWN0aW9uLCBjcmVhdGVSZWR1Y2VyLCBvbiB9IGZyb20gJ0BuZ3J4L3N0b3JlJztcclxuaW1wb3J0IHsgbG9naW5BY3Rpb24sIH0gZnJvbSAnLi4vYWN0aW9ucyc7XHJcblxyXG5cclxuZXhwb3J0IGludGVyZmFjZSBMb2dpblN0YXRlIHtcclxuICBpc0xvZ2luOiBib29sZWFuO1xyXG59XHJcblxyXG5leHBvcnQgY29uc3QgaW5pdGlhbFN0YXRlOiBMb2dpblN0YXRlID0ge1xyXG4gIGlzTG9naW46IGZhbHNlLFxyXG59O1xyXG5cclxuY29uc3QgX2xvZ2luUmVkdWNlciA9IGNyZWF0ZVJlZHVjZXIoXHJcbiAgaW5pdGlhbFN0YXRlLFxyXG4gIG9uKGxvZ2luQWN0aW9uLCAoc3RhdGUsIHsgaXNMb2dpbiB9KSA9PiAoeyAuLi5zdGF0ZSwgaXNMb2dpbiB9KSlcclxuKTtcclxuXHJcbmV4cG9ydCBmdW5jdGlvbiBMb2dpblJlZHVjZXIoc3RhdGU6IExvZ2luU3RhdGUgfCB1bmRlZmluZWQsIGFjdGlvbjogQWN0aW9uKSB7XHJcbiAgcmV0dXJuIF9sb2dpblJlZHVjZXIoc3RhdGUsIGFjdGlvbik7XHJcbn1cclxuIl19